BMW 7-Series Gas Mileage (MPG)
Unlike other fuel economy surveys, TrueDelta's Real-World Gas Mileage Survey includes questions about how and where a car was driven. So you can get an idea of the BMW 7-Series's real-world MPG based on how and where you drive a car.

| With the turbocharged 400hp 4.4L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2010 BMW 7-Series fuel economy has been averaging
14.0 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2010 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ly in the suburbs (about 75 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in heavy traffic (10 percent), in the city (10 percent), and on the highway at an average speed of 80 miles per hour (5 percent). In addition the average 2010 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on flat terrain with a medium foot and the AC on most or all of the time. |

| With the 360-horsepower 4.8L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, the 2008 BMW 7-Series has been averaging
19.0 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2008 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 75 miles per hour (about 50 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in heavy traffic (20 percent), in the suburbs (20 percent), and in the city (10 percent). In addition the average 2008 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on hilly terrain with a medium foot and the AC on only some of the time. |

| With the 360-horsepower 4.8L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2007 BMW 7-Series gas mileage has been averaging
26.7 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2007 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 70 miles per hour (about 80 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the suburbs (20 percent), in heavy traffic (0 percent), and in the city (0 percent). In addition the average 2007 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on flat terrain with a light foot and the AC on only some of the time. |

| With the 360-horsepower 4.8L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2006 BMW 7-Series fuel economy has been averaging
21.5 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2006 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 72 miles per hour (about 56 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the city (26 percent), in the suburbs (12 percent), and in heavy traffic (6 percent). In addition the average 2006 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on hilly terrain with a medium foot and the AC on most or all of the time. |

| With the 325-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, the 2004 BMW 7-Series has been averaging
20.9 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2004 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ly in the suburbs (about 40 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the city (28 percent), in heavy traffic (23 percent), and on the highway at an average speed of 65 miles per hour (10 percent). In addition the average 2004 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on hilly terrain with a medium foot and the AC on only some of the time. |

| With the 325-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2003 BMW 7-Series gas mileage has been averaging
20.8 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2003 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ly in heavy traffic (about 45 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were on the highway at an average speed of 60 miles per hour (30 percent), in the city (20 percent), and in the suburbs (5 percent). In addition the average 2003 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on flat terrain with a light foot and the AC not used at all. |

| With the 325-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2002 BMW 7-Series fuel economy has been averaging
19.0 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2002 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ly in the city (about 50 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the suburbs (30 percent), on the highway at an average speed of 75 miles per hour (20 percent), and in heavy traffic (0 percent). In addition the average 2002 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on flat terrain with a medium foot and the AC on only some of the time. |

| With the 282-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 5-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, the 2001 BMW 7-Series has been averaging
20.7 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2001 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 70 miles per hour (about 38 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the city (28 percent), in heavy traffic (27 percent), and in the suburbs (7 percent). In addition the average 2001 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on hilly terrain with a medium foot and the AC on most or all of the time. |

| With the 282-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 5-speed autom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2001 BMW 7-Series gas mileage has been averaging
27.5 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2001 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 75 miles per hour (about 75 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the city (10 percent), in heavy traffic (10 percent), and in the suburbs (5 percent). In addition the average 2001 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on flat terrain with a medium foot and the AC on only some of the time. |

| With the 282-horsepower 4.4L V8 engine, 5-speed shiftable autom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ive, 2000 BMW 7-Series fuel economy has been averaging
20.3 MPG (miles per gallon). The 2000 BMW 7-Series in this analysis were driven mostly on the highway at an average speed of 80 miles per hour (about 85 percent of the miles driven). The rest of the miles were in the suburbs (10 percent), in the city (4 percent), and in heavy traffic (1 percent). In addition the average 2000 BMW 7-Series in this analysis was driven on hilly terrain with a lead foot and the AC on most or all of the time. |
